The following letter was sent to the Ministry of Transportation and copied to Coast Reporter.
I have some serious concerns about Highway 101 and the volume of traffic.
My question now is how much time, money and lives have to be lost before the Ministry of Transportation recognizes the unsafe volume conditions on this highway?
I've grown up on the Sunshine Coast, and I have never seen volumes so high on our highway. In the last two years, there have been several serious accidents, including a fully-loaded logging truck overturning on the highway at a location where there was no alternative route available. In the middle of the busy tourist season, it's a miracle that no one was injured.
I am calling for a review of the portion of Highway 101 that connects Langdale to Egmont and for an adequate plan to be conceived to address the abhorrent, unsafe highway conditions.
